草庐IT

php dns 记录

全部标签

mysql - 选择给定时间段内某种类型的第一条记录

我有一个存储用户评论的数据库表:comments(id,user_id,created_at)从该表中,我想获得在过去7天内首次发表评论的用户数。这是我目前所拥有的:SELECTCOUNT(DISTINCT`user_id`)FROM`comments`WHERE`created_at`BETWEENDATE_SUB(NOW(),INTERVAL7DAY)ANDNOW()这会给出发表评论的用户数量,但不会考虑这些评论是否是他们用户的第一条评论。 最佳答案 SELECTCOUNT(DISTINCTuser_id)FROMcomment

java - 获取最后插入记录的主键

我有一个名为Driver的实体类,我的主键生成机制是@Id@GeneratedValue(strategy=GenerationType.AUTO)privateLongid;现在我需要给Driver添加“driverCode”属性,它应该是带有前缀(dri1,dri2)的唯一值,“dri”是前缀值,key应该是Driver的主键值,我想要在第一次创建驱动程序时添加driverCode,为此我需要获取最后插入的驱动程序的主键,添加一个,并与前缀连接,任何人都可以告诉如何在之前获取最后插入的记录的主键插入一条新记录,有什么简单的方法吗?,提前谢谢你, 最佳答案

mysql - 删除重复记录,随机保留一条

按照目前的情况,这个问题不适合我们的问答形式。我们希望答案得到事实、引用或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ter指导。关闭10年前。如何在MYSQL中删除重复记录并随机保留一条记录?

c++ hook 键盘与输入法记录到txt

windows系统,自己程序中,如果想记录用户输入的内容,可以用hookvs2022新建一个dll工程keyboard.h//MathLibrary.h-Containsdeclarationsofmathfunctions#pragmaonce#ifdefMATHLIBRARY_EXPORTS#defineMATHLIBRARY_API__declspec(dllexport)#else#defineMATHLIBRARY_API__declspec(dllimport)#endif#include#include"windows.h"usingnamespacestd;extern"C"M

mysql - 如何在名称字段中使用单个空格更新 mySQL 中的 200000 条记录

我的数据库中有超过200000条包含客户姓名和信息的记录。客户姓名的名字和姓氏之间有很多空格。ex.1.ADAMSCRAIG2.GABRIELGEANETTE3.KRANTZAUDREY如何删除中间的空格。喜欢ex.1.ADAMSCRAIG2.GABRIELGEANETTE3.KRANTZAUDREY任何帮助将不胜感激。谢谢你, 最佳答案 Takenfromthefollowinganswer...并稍作修改以执行更新:UPDATEYourTableSETName=replace(replace(replace(LTrim(RTri

php - MySql -- 如何记录使用过的条目?

我有一个应用程序(更可能是一个测验应用程序),我在MySQL数据库中保存了我所有的1000个测验,当用户请求一个问题时,我想从这个表中检索一个随机问题,我可以使用RAND轻松地做到这一点()functioninMySQL..我的问题是,我不想向用户提出相同的问题两次或更多次,我怎样才能记录检索到的问题?我是否必须为每个用户创建表?这不会增加加载时间吗??请帮助我,任何帮助都会帮我一个大忙..-问候 最佳答案 如果您需要的时间很短,请为此使用用户的$_SESSION。如果您需要长期(比如明天,而不是问相同的问题)-您必须为usersT

php - 从考虑中删除 5 个最新记录

我正在制作一个特色页面,其中列出了不同类别的记录。5个最新,5个最少观看,5个最多观看..那部分不难:最新:SELECTTOP5*ORDERBYID_RecordDESC最少:SELECT*FROMtbl_NameWHEREORDERBYHits_FieldLIMIT5大多数:SELECT*FROMtbl_NameWHEREORDERBYHits_FieldDESCLIMIT5这是我的问题..因为最新的记录可能是最少查看的,所以它们可能会出现在两个查询中。我想从考虑中删除5个最新记录。我如何编写这样的SQL语句:SELECT*FROMtbl_NameWHERE(NOTTHE5NEWES

mysql - MySQL数据库中的记录数

好吧,这应该足以获取当前数据库中所有记录的数量:SELECTSUM(TABLE_ROWS)FROMINFORMATION_SCHEMA.TABLESWHERETABLE_SCHEMA=DATABASE();令人惊讶的是,每次执行上述语句时,我都会得到不同的数字!首先我以为我的数据库有问题。但它与MySQL开发人员提供的示例数据库相同。多次在sakila上执行上述语句会产生以下值:4636248104451704706048139我做错了什么?这是一个错误吗? 最佳答案 这是InnoDB的东西——你可以改为在表上计数(id),但它很慢

使用XSLT基于多个标签的多个值组合记录

我对我一直在尝试使用的一个文件感到困惑XSLT。我想要这种类型的输出:EmpID|Languages|LanguageAbility|LanguagePro|Certificate-Issuer|Certification|Certificate-ID000626390|English|Overall||C1|C2|000626390|Turkish|Overall||||XML:这是我代码的示例XML000626390EnglishOverallTurkishOverallC1C2看答案由于您的示例XML不包含任何Leganchapro和Certficate-ID,因此我们假设它是语言的兄弟

mysql - 选择 codeigniter 中其他表中不存在的记录

我使用以下查询从表中选择行。Table1:iddescriptionstatusadd_datetopicid1xyz022-3-1352pqr021-3-1353abc020-3-1354sdd022-3-135Table2:idotherid1223此查询为我提供了表1中的所有记录,但我想选择那些不在表2中的记录。像table1'id'不存在于table2'otherid'中。在我的例子中,我想从表1中为ID1和4选择记录。因为它在表2中不作为“otherid”存在。$topicid=5;$q=$this->db->select(array('t1.idasid','t1.desc